Explicit Function

A function where the dependent variable y is isolated on one side of the equation.

2
New cards

Implicit Function

A relationship where x and y are intermixed in an equation and may not pass the vertical line test.

3
New cards

Implicit Differentiation

A technique used to find the derivative of y with respect to x without isolating y.

4
New cards

Chain Rule

A rule that states when differentiating a composite function, the derivative is the derivative of the outer function times the derivative of the inner function.

5
New cards

Horizontal Tangent

Occurs when the slope of the tangent line is 0; set the numerator of the derivative equal to 0.

6
New cards

Vertical Tangent

Occurs when the slope of the tangent line is undefined; set the denominator of the derivative equal to 0.
